Transaction d72f00a55dd97e41414ad86765a6d9f3f1a5ae930ad20abc0ff5a18d32a89e69

block
617823171a95726881c51dccf4e6cfeffaef80663020e55c49e39fabdf8cd5ef

1 Input

3 Outputs